Commercial Construction Welder
Company:** HB Global, LLC
Job Summary
HB Global, LLC is seeking a skilled Commercial Construction Welder to join our team. This role involves performing a variety of welding tasks on commercial construction projects, ensuring high-quality, durable, and safe structural components.
Job Responsibilities
- Read and interpret blueprints, schematics, and welding specifications to determine the appropriate welding process and materials.
- Execute various welding techniques including Stick (SMAW), MIG (GMAW), TIG (GTAW), and Flux-Cored (FCAW) on steel, stainless steel, and other common construction materials.
- Fabricate, assemble, and install structural steel components, beams, columns, and other metal parts according to project plans and safety standards.
- Operate and maintain welding equipment, including arc welders, oxy-acetylene torches, grinders, and other power tools.
- Inspect welds for quality, integrity, and adherence to specifications, performing repairs as needed.
- Adhere to all company safety policies and procedures, including wearing app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E).
- Collaborate effectively with other construction trades, supervisors, and project managers.
- Perform routine maintenance on welding equipment and workspace to ensure optimal functionality and safety.
- Assist with material handling, rigging, and other general labor tasks as required on the job site.
- Maintain accurate records of work performed, materials used, and any issues encountered.
